Vehicle Profile: 2013 Mercedes-Benz C250 Sedan
Have your compact sedan and a Mercedes-Benz, too

Photo: 2013 Mercedes-Benz C250 Sedan
Mercedes-Benz transforms the idea of the compact sedan with the C250. The C-Class sedan was thoroughly redesigned for the 2012 model year, an effort that included more than 2,000 new parts––like bumpers, headlamps, an aluminum hood and LED taillights––and hefty interior design work. For 2013, the C-Class features another round of changes.

Car Care: Fuel System
Your fuel system is complex, so trust the experts


At the heart of any vehicle is the engine, but without fuel to burn, an engine is just a useless lump of metal, plastic and rubber. The fuel system is responsible for feeding the engine and primarily consists of the tank, fuel lines, fuel filter and a pump that pushes the fuel from the tank to either an injection system or, in older vehicles, a carburetor.
